MGCL V10
V10
MGCL V10
|
Defines default values of each class. [詳解]
静的公開メンバ関数 | |
static const MGBox & | null_box () |
Return null box. [詳解] | |
static const MGBox & | empty_box () |
Return empty 3D box. m_empty_box を返却。 [詳解] | |
static const MGBox & | empty_box_2D () |
Return empty 2D box. m_empty_box_2D を返却。 [詳解] | |
static const MGInterval & | empty_interval () |
Return empty interval. m_empty_interval を返却。 [詳解] | |
static const MGTransf & | null_transf () |
Return null transformation. [詳解] | |
static const MGTransf & | identity_transf () |
Return 4 by 4 unit transformation. m_identity_transf を返却。 [詳解] | |
static const MGTransf & | identity_transf_2D () |
Return 3 by 3 unit transformation. m_identity_transf_2D を返却。 [詳解] | |
static const MGPosition & | origin () |
Return 3D origin point(0,0,0). m_origin を返却。 [詳解] | |
static const MGPosition & | origin_2D () |
Return 2D origin point(0,0). m_origin_2D を返却。 [詳解] | |
static const MGMatrix & | null_matrix () |
Return null matrix. [詳解] | |
static const MGMatrix & | unit_matrix () |
Return 3 by 3 unit matrix. m_unit_matrix を返却。 [詳解] | |
static const MGMatrix & | unit_matrix_2D () |
Return 2 by 2 unit matrix. m_unit_matrix_2D を返却。 [詳解] | |
static const MGVector & | x_unit_vector_2D () |
Return x axis unit vector. m_x_unit_vector_2D を返却。 [詳解] | |
static const MGVector & | y_unit_vector_2D () |
Return y axis unit vector. m_y_unit_vector_2D を返却。 [詳解] | |
static const MGVector & | x_unit_vector () |
Return x axis unit vector. m_x_unit_vector を返却。 [詳解] | |
static const MGVector & | y_unit_vector () |
Return y axis unit vector. m_y_unit_vector を返却。 [詳解] | |
static const MGVector & | z_unit_vector () |
Return z axis unit vector. m_z_unit_vector を返却。 [詳解] | |
static const MGPosition & | null_position () |
Return null position. [詳解] | |
static const MGVector & | null_vector () |
Return null vector. [詳解] | |
static const MGVector & | zero_vector () |
Return 3D zero vector. m_zero_vector を返却。 [詳解] | |
static const MGVector & | zero_vector_2D () |
Return 2D zero vector. m_zero_vector_2D を返却。 [詳解] | |
static const MGKnotVector & | null_knot_vector () |
Return null knot vector. m_null_knot_vector を返却。 [詳解] | |
static const MGKnotVector & | infinite_knot_vector () |
Return infinite knot vector. m_infinite_knot_vector を返却。 [詳解] | |
フレンド | |
MG_DLL_DECLR friend std::ostream & | operator<< (std::ostream &, const MGDefault &) |
String stream function. [詳解] | |
Defines default values of each class.
|
inlinestatic |
Return empty 3D box. m_empty_box を返却。
|
inlinestatic |
Return empty 2D box. m_empty_box_2D を返却。
|
inlinestatic |
Return empty interval. m_empty_interval を返却。
|
inlinestatic |
Return 4 by 4 unit transformation. m_identity_transf を返却。
|
inlinestatic |
Return 3 by 3 unit transformation. m_identity_transf_2D を返却。
|
inlinestatic |
Return infinite knot vector. m_infinite_knot_vector を返却。
|
inlinestatic |
Return null box.
void constructor MGDefault();
|
inlinestatic |
Return null knot vector. m_null_knot_vector を返却。
|
inlinestatic |
Return null matrix.
|
inlinestatic |
Return null position.
|
inlinestatic |
Return null transformation.
|
inlinestatic |
Return null vector.
|
inlinestatic |
Return 3D origin point(0,0,0). m_origin を返却。
|
inlinestatic |
Return 2D origin point(0,0). m_origin_2D を返却。
|
inlinestatic |
Return 3 by 3 unit matrix. m_unit_matrix を返却。
|
inlinestatic |
Return 2 by 2 unit matrix. m_unit_matrix_2D を返却。
|
inlinestatic |
Return x axis unit vector. m_x_unit_vector を返却。
|
inlinestatic |
Return x axis unit vector. m_x_unit_vector_2D を返却。
|
inlinestatic |
Return y axis unit vector. m_y_unit_vector を返却。
|
inlinestatic |
Return y axis unit vector. m_y_unit_vector_2D を返却。
|
inlinestatic |
Return z axis unit vector. m_z_unit_vector を返却。
|
inlinestatic |
Return 3D zero vector. m_zero_vector を返却。
|
inlinestatic |
Return 2D zero vector. m_zero_vector_2D を返却。
|
friend |
String stream function.